Description:

Description for B&B:

Our recently renovated home on the first floor offers four bedrooms, all designated as non-smoking areas. Guests have access to a communal kitchen free of charge to prepare their meals, with the only request being to clean up after themselves. We kindly ask that animals are not brought into the rooms out of consideration for our hosts.

Check-in time is between 17:30 and 19:00, and check-out is in the morning before 11:00. Upon arrival, guests are required to provide payment, with a 30% deposit needed at the time of booking.

We also offer various complimentary services upon request, including chairs, strollers, plastic toilets, bath accessories, hairdryers, fans, and irons. Additionally, we have a selection of games and books available for guests to enjoy. If there are any other specific requests, please don't hesitate to ask when making your reservation.

Directions

- If you are coming from Troyes:
Proceed through the town center and make a right turn after passing the second red light onto Rue Louis Desprez. After traveling for approximately 1.5 km, take a left turn onto "Rue de l'Europe."

- If you are coming from Chaumont:
After encountering the first red light, make a right turn onto Rue Louis Desprez. Follow the same instructions as mentioned above.

Attractions

  • Château de Bar-sur-Aube: Located in the heart of Bar-sur-Aube, this medieval castle offers a fascinating glimpse into history. Explore its well-preserved architecture, climb the tower for panoramic views, and learn about the castle's role in the region's past.
  • Musée Napoléon: Situated in Brienne-le-Château, just a short drive from Bar-sur-Aube, this museum is dedicated to Napoleon Bonaparte. Discover a vast collection of artifacts, paintings, and memorabilia related to the life and military career of the famous French emperor.
  • Les Riceys: A picturesque village renowned for its vineyards and champagne production, Les Riceys is a must-visit for wine enthusiasts. Take a stroll through the vineyards, visit local wineries for tastings, and appreciate the charming rural setting.
  • Abbaye de Clairvaux: Located in Ville-sous-la-Ferté, approximately 30 minutes from Bar-sur-Aube, this former Cistercian monastery is an architectural gem. Explore the impressive ruins, walk through the tranquil gardens, and learn about the abbey's rich history.
  • Lac d'Orient: A beautiful lake nestled in the heart of the Champagne region, Lac d'Orient offers numerous recreational activities. Enjoy swimming, boating, fishing, or simply relax on its sandy beaches surrounded by scenic landscapes.
  • Musée du Cristal Saint-Louis: Situated in Saint-Louis-lès-Bitche, this museum showcases the art of crystal glassmaking. Discover the intricate craftsmanship, admire exquisite crystal pieces, and learn about the history and techniques behind this traditional craft.
  • Nigloland: An amusement park located in Dolancourt, Nigloland offers a fun-filled day for families and thrill-seekers. With a variety of rides, shows, and attractions for all ages, it guarantees an enjoyable experience amidst beautiful park surroundings.
  • Troyes: Approximately 30 kilometers from Bar-sur-Aube, Troyes is a charming medieval city renowned for its well-preserved half-timbered houses and Gothic churches. Explore its historic center, visit museums, and indulge in shopping at its famous factory outlet stores.
  • Parc Naturel Régional de la Forêt d'Orient: Situated near Lac d'Orient, this regional natural park is a paradise for nature lovers. Discover vast forests, tranquil lakes, and diverse wildlife. Enjoy hiking, cycling, or birdwatching in this peaceful and preserved environment. 10. Musée de Vauluisant: Located in Troyes, this museum offers a fascinating insight into the history of the Champagne region. Discover ancient artifacts, learn about local traditions, and explore the underground cellars showcasing the production of champagne. These attractions near 11 Rue de l'Europe in Bar-sur-Aube provide a diverse range of cultural, historical, natural, and recreational experiences for visitors to enjoy.
